Tewksbury Man Arrested for Drug Offense at Chelmsford Wal-Mart

The following was supplied by the Chelmsford Police Department. Where arrests or charges are mentioned, it does not indicate a conviction.

Chelmsford Police Department officers made several arrests in recent days. Below are those arrests, which do not indicate a conviction.

Wednesday, August 6

· At 9:04 p.m., officers attempted to serve paperwork to a resident on Dennison Road. Officers located and arrested Andrew S. Gordon, 52, of 4 Dennison Road, North Chelmsford. He was charged with violating a domestic restraining order.

Thursday, August 7

· Police were off with a suspicious man on Drum Hill Road at Wal-Mart for a suspected drug offense at 8:49 p.m. Following the incident, Chelmsford Police arrested Michael Codner, 27, of 34 Cinnamon Circle, Tewksbury. Codner was charged with subsequent offense of possession of Class A drugs.

Saturday, August 9

· Officers were off at the entrance to a business on Chelmsford with a man and a woman acting suspiciously. Police arrested Michael W. Carey, 32, of 50 Atkinson Street, Methuen. Carey was charged on an outstanding warrant for shoplifting and also charged with receiving stolen property greater than $250.
